Summary
A vulnerability was found in Discourse up to 3.0.1/3.1.0.beta2 and classified as problematic. The affected element is the function display_personal_messages_tag_counts of the component Message Handler. Such manipulation leads to information disclosure.
This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2023-23935. The attack can be launched remotely. No exploit exists.
It is best practice to apply a patch to resolve this issue.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Discourse up to 3.0.1/3.1.0.beta2. It has been rated as problematic. Affected by this issue is the function display_personal_messages_tag_counts of the component Message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a information disclosure v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-200. The product exposes sensitive information to an actor that is not explicitly authorized to have access to that information. Impacted is confidentiality. CVE summarizes:
Discourse is an open-source messaging platform. In versions 3.0.1 and prior on the `stable` branch and versions 3.1.0.beta2 and prior on the `beta` and `tests-passed` branches, the count of personal messages displayed for a tag is a count of all personal messages regardless of whether the personal message is visible to a given user. As a result, any users can technically poll a sensitive tag to determine if a new personal message is created even if the user does not have access to the personal message. In the patched versions, the count of personal messages tagged with a given tag is hidden by default. To revert to the old behaviour of displaying the count of personal messages for a given tag, an admin may enable the `display_personal_messages_tag_counts` site setting.
The weakness was disclosed 03/17/2023 as GHSA-rf8j-mf8c-82v7. The advisory is available at github.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2023-23935 since 01/19/2023. Successful exploitation requires user interaction by the victim. Technical details are known, but there is no available exploit. This vulnerability is assigned to T1592 by the MITRE ATT&CK project.
Applying the patch f31f0b70f82c43d93220ce6fc0d4f57440452f37 is able to eliminate this problem. The bugfix is ready for download at github.com.
